**NOT COMPLETE** The conflict rages on, inside and out. No one is safe from the truth that has been buried underneath the skin. While stranded on a planet that has become anything but desolate, Mariona must discover an escape from reality. Yet, she can only fall deeper into the dark. Throughout the second adaption of her story, Mariona fights the lies she has been convinced to believe, becoming more torn between her mind and reality as the events carry out. Light has brought on many happy moments for her, although she has trouble exploring her emotions. There are happy moments in dreams, but sometimes we are forced to only remember our nightmares.
